Product Manager
It began with a recruiter call asking about my availability for an onsite meeting and some brief questions about my experience. Then, HR contacted me to schedule an interview with the team leader and a manager. This ~2-hour round was very technical, covering the subject matter (NGS analysis) and personal aspects like handling deadlines. I was told I'd hear back the following week, but it took a month to get invited to their headquarters for a ~1-hour meeting with HR, which felt like a psychological evaluation with many personal questions. I also met two friendly PMs. Again, they said I'd get a response within a week, but I was ghosted for two months. Eventually, I received an automated rejection email. Furthermore, it took them over two months to reimburse my travel expenses.
- How do you handle criticism?
Team Member
I interviewed with a group leader, team coordinator, and another team member for about an hour. They each introduced themselves and their jobs, and then asked me to do the same. The group leader and team member were nice, but the coordinator seemed a bit down, which made things a little awkward. They said I'd hear back that week, but I didn't get any news for three weeks. I had to reach out myself to find out I wasn't chosen.
- Can you introduce yourself?
- What are your thoughts on cloning and vector types?
- What kind of media do you use?

R&D Reagents Team Member
A few days after applying, I was invited to a first online interview. They asked about my studies (I'm a career starter) and my skills and experience. There were a few technical questions, but nothing too difficult if you've familiarized yourself with the job beforehand. Then a couple of personal questions. Shortly after the interview, I was invited to a second in-person meeting. Here I had to present my master's thesis in 15 minutes, then I was asked a few more questions/I asked questions. Afterward, I got a tour of the company and the labs. They offered me 'du' right at the beginning, and I felt very comfortable. All in all, I found the interviews very pleasant and the process very fast and uncomplicated.
- What experience do you have? Also questions about your studies.
- Some technical questions.
- What do you like to do/not like to do (in a job)?
